Transaction 22658632669840dbb40ce3c8b4fca684a96c9818cb9c2c481695f3aec746d2cb

1 Input
2 Outputs
  • 22658632669840dbb40ce3c8b4fca684a96c9818cb9c2c481695f3aec746d2cb:0
  • value  37106585
    address  17BKrDc9NsMe9rzmzwGcexFnoMb5ESXZhs
  • 22658632669840dbb40ce3c8b4fca684a96c9818cb9c2c481695f3aec746d2cb:1
  • value  1360375
    address  1NK1gKE3Nst1dDLvWNXmzSkK8HxwwuZKkT